Possible reason was that I was using 4.7 M resistor in the circuit, though N5ESE had suggested lowering the value according to the impedance of the multimeter. 4.7 M resistor was for a nominal 11 M multimeter impedance. The maximum which I could get for my digital multimeter was only about 1 M in the highest DC voltage range. So I removed the 4.7 M resistor in the probe and replaced it with a 470 K resistor, near to the 430 K resistor suggested by N5ESE.
